site stats

Sas create variable based on condition

WebbSAS enables you to create multiple SAS data sets in a single DATA step using an OUTPUT statement: OUTPUT < SAS-data-set(s) >; When you use an OUTPUT statement without … Webb10 aug. 2016 · You should use regular loops instead of macro loops, because number of iteration is dynamic depends on number_of_years variable. data uprava; set …

Creating Subsets of Observations: Conditionally Writing

Webb6 jan. 2016 · Creating New Variables Using if-then; if-then-else; and if-then-else-then Statements An if-then statement can be used to create a new variable for a selected subset of the observations. For each observation in the data set, SAS evaluates the expression following the if. When the expression is true, the statement following then is … Webb19 juli 2016 · SAS Data Science; Mathematical Optimization, Discrete-Event Simulation, and OR; SAS/IML Software and Matrix Computations; SAS Forecasting and Econometrics; … happy national technology day https://kathurpix.com

SAS Variables: Ways to Create Variables

Webb14 jan. 2024 · Method 1: Delete Rows Based on One Condition data new_data; set original_data; if var1 = "string" then delete; run; Method 2: Delete Rows Based on Several Conditions data new_data; set original_data; if var1 = "string" and var2 < 10 then delete; run; Method 3: Delete Rows Based on One of Several Conditions Webb6 maj 2024 · Hello STATA Experts: I am trying to create a new variable based on the existence of certain conditions in two existing variables (see code below). It appears to be dropping most of the cases for "Fathers". Not sure what is wrong here. Also, how is this treating missing variables? Any help would be appreciated. Pat generate parentfigure=. Webb6 dec. 2024 · If you create a new variable in your Data Step, you can’t use the WHERE statement to filter based on this new variable. SAS will show an error like “ERROR: Variable X is not on file Y.”. Instead, the IF statement is capable of filtering data based on new variables. The IF statement can be used to subset your data into two or more new … chaloori prathima

if condition - create new variable - SAS

Category:Creating Subsets of Observations: Selecting Observations for a

Tags:Sas create variable based on condition

Sas create variable based on condition

define workflow process

Webb6 jan. 2016 · SAS will keep evaluating the if-then-else-if statements until it encounters the first true statement. Character variable data must always be enclosed in quotes. The … Webb8 jan. 2015 · This tells SAS that the macro variables number_text and number_text_2 should be accessible outside of the macro, which should fix your problem. I also …

Sas create variable based on condition

Did you know?

WebbWe are currently hiring a Remote Healthcare Data Scientist! If you are an experienced data scientist with statistical experience, and value being part of a team that makes a difference, you may be the right person for the position! Apply today! JOB SPECIFICATIONS Classification: EXEMPT Status: FULL-TIME, Monday - Friday, generally 8am to 5pm, … WebbThe most common method for implementing conditional logic using SAS software, and probably the first learned by most SAS programmers, is the IF…THEN…ELSE statement. …

Webb26 aug. 2024 · In this situation, many SAS programmers choose one of the following methods: Inside a DATA step, use the SYMPUT call to create a macro variable that … I would want create a new variable with a condition if x1 is positive the new variable takes 1 else 0. My directory is 'dir' and my sas dataset is 'exemple'. SAS not creates me the x2 variable. data dir.exemple; set exemple; if x1&lt;0 then x2=1; else x2=0; end; run; NOTE: Variable x1 is uninitialized.

Webb19 mars 2024 · By default, SAS creates a report with the Frequency, Percentage, Cumulative Frequency, and Cumulative Percentage. If you are only interested in the Frequency, then you need to add the NOPERCENT, NOROW, and NOCOL options. proc freq data =sashelp.cars; table type *origin / nopercent norow nocol; run; Do you know? Webb13 jan. 2024 · Here are the two most common ways to create new variables in SAS: Method 1: Create Variables from Scratch data original_data; input var1 $ var2 var3; …

WebbSAS evaluates the expression in an IF-THEN statement to produce a result that is either non-zero, zero, or missing. A non-zero and nonmissing result causes the expression to be true; a result of zero or missing causes the expression to be false.

Webb7 dec. 2024 · To create a variable based on existing variable, you write down the name of your new variable, followed by the equal sign, and a function that returns a character … happy national sports dayWebbVi skulle vilja visa dig en beskrivning här men webbplatsen du tittar på tillåter inte detta. chalo optical bramptonWebbThe survival function S ( t ), is the probability that a subject survives longer than time t. S ( t) is theoretically a smooth curve, but it is usually estimated using the Kaplan–Meier (KM) curve. The graph shows the KM plot for the aml data and can be interpreted as follows: happy national what is todayWebbOne way to make the selection is to delete observations in which the value of Nights is not equal to 6: if Nights ne 6 then delete; A more straightforward way is to select only … chalopadheWebb1 okt. 2015 · Abstract Background Nurses are expected to deliver pre-discharge heart failure education in 8 content areas: what heart failure means, medications, diet, activity, weight monitoring, fluid restriction, signs/symptoms of worsening condition and signs/symptoms of fluid overload. Aims To examine nurses’ comfort in and frequency of … happy national vinyl record dayWebbYou can create a variable and specify its format or informat with a FORMAT or an INFORMAT statement. For example, the following FORMAT statement creates a variable … happy national unity dayWebb1 aug. 2024 · Some patients are diagnosed with multiple cancers and the sequence variable records in what order cancers were diagnosed. Problems with the sequence values can occur from errors at the time of manual data entry or through historical changes in coding standards for this variable. chal op